The Cloudscape: Exploring the Pros and Cons of a Multicloud Strategy

  • Home
  • Career Advice
image
image
image
image
image
image
image
image


The Cloudscape: Exploring the Pros and Cons of a Multicloud Strategy

The Cloudscape: Exploring the Pros and Cons of a Multicloud Strategy

Introduction:

In the ever-evolving realm of cloud computing, businesses are continually seeking strategies that provide flexibility, scalability, and optimal performance. One approach gaining traction is the adoption of a multicloud strategy. But, as with any innovation, there are both advantages and challenges associated with this approach. In this blog post, we'll take a deep dive into the pros and cons of a multicloud strategy, exploring the nuances that can impact your organization's digital journey.


The Pros of a Multicloud Strategy:
1. Enhanced Flexibility and Vendor Diversity:

One of the standout advantages of a multicloud strategy is the enhanced flexibility it brings. By leveraging services from multiple cloud providers, organizations can tailor their infrastructure to meet specific needs. This approach also reduces dependence on a single vendor, mitigating the risks associated with service outages, pricing fluctuations, or changes in terms of service.


2. Improved Performance and Redundancy:

Distributing workloads across multiple cloud platforms can significantly enhance overall system performance. A multicloud strategy allows organizations to capitalize on the strengths of different providers, optimizing for specific tasks or geographical locations. This redundancy also acts as a safety net, ensuring continuous operations even if one provider experiences downtime.


3. Cost Optimization and Competitive Pricing:

In a multicloud environment, organizations have the flexibility to choose services based on competitive pricing models. This competitive landscape often results in cost savings as businesses can select the most cost-effective solutions for each workload. Additionally, multicloud strategies enable better cost management by avoiding vendor lock-in and facilitating efficient resource allocation.


4. Geographic Reach and Compliance:

Multicloud architectures empower organizations to distribute workloads across data centers located in different regions. This geographical diversity enhances global reach, allowing businesses to provide low-latency access to users around the world. Moreover, it aids in compliance with data sovereignty regulations by allowing data to reside in specific regions as required by local laws.


5. Innovation Acceleration:

Embracing a multicloud approach fosters an environment conducive to innovation. With access to a variety of tools and services from different providers, organizations can experiment with cutting-edge technologies without the constraints of a single-vendor ecosystem. This agility can be a catalyst for digital transformation and continuous improvement.


The Cons of a Multicloud Strategy:
1. Increased Complexity in Management:

While a multicloud strategy offers flexibility, it also introduces a layer of complexity in terms of management. Coordinating and optimizing workloads across different platforms can be challenging. Organizations must invest in skilled personnel or advanced management tools to navigate this complexity effectively.


2. Interoperability and Integration Challenges:

Ensuring seamless interoperability and integration between various cloud providers is a significant hurdle. Differences in APIs, data formats, and management interfaces may require additional development effort and result in compatibility challenges. Organizations need robust integration strategies to prevent silos and maximize the benefits of a multicloud environment.


3. Potential Security Risks:

Security is a paramount concern in any cloud strategy, and multicloud is no exception. Managing security consistently across diverse environments can be intricate, increasing the risk of misconfigurations or overlooking vulnerabilities. Organizations need a robust security framework, including encryption, access controls, and continuous monitoring, to mitigate these risks effectively.


4. Cost of Data Transfer and Egress:

While multicloud can offer cost savings, data transfer and egress costs can add up. Transferring large volumes of data between different cloud providers may incur additional charges. Organizations must carefully consider their data transfer patterns and evaluate the associated costs to avoid unexpected expenses.


5. Vendor Lock-in Concerns Persist:

While a multicloud strategy aims to reduce dependency on a single vendor, there is still the risk of vendor lock-in. Each cloud provider has its proprietary features and services, and extensive use of these may make it challenging to switch providers without significant effort. Organizations need a well-thought-out strategy to minimize dependencies and maintain flexibility.


Strategies for Success in a Multicloud Environment:
1. Comprehensive Planning and Assessment:

Successful adoption of a multicloud strategy begins with comprehensive planning. Organizations should assess their specific needs, evaluate the strengths and weaknesses of different providers, and develop a clear roadmap for implementation. Understanding the intricacies of your workloads and data requirements is fundamental to making informed decisions.


2. Invest in Skill Development:

Given the complexity of managing a multicloud environment, investing in skill development is crucial. Providing training for your IT team or hiring professionals with expertise in multicloud architectures and management tools can significantly enhance your organization's ability to navigate the challenges associated with this strategy.


3. Embrace Automation and Orchestration:

Automation and orchestration play pivotal roles in streamlining the management of a multicloud environment. Implementing automated processes for deployment, scaling, and monitoring can reduce manual errors and enhance overall efficiency. Orchestration tools help coordinate workflows across different cloud providers, simplifying the complexities of a multicloud ecosystem.


4. Prioritize Security from the Onset:

Security should be a top priority when adopting a multicloud strategy. Implementing robust security measures, including encryption, identity and access management, and regular security audits, is essential. A proactive approach to security minimizes the risk of breaches and ensures the confidentiality and integrity of your data across multiple clouds.


5. Continuously Monitor and Optimize:

Regular monitoring and optimization are integral components of managing a multicloud environment. Implement monitoring tools to track performance, costs, and security metrics across different platforms. This continuous monitoring allows organizations to identify and address issues promptly and optimize resource utilization for cost efficiency.


Conclusion: Striking the Right Balance

In the ever-evolving landscape of cloud computing, a multicloud strategy presents both opportunities and challenges. Success lies in striking the right balance, aligning the strategy with organizational goals, and effectively navigating the complexities involved. By understanding the pros and cons outlined above and implementing thoughtful strategies for success, businesses can leverage the benefits of a multicloud approach, driving innovation, and achieving agility in an increasingly dynamic digital environment. So, as you navigate the cloudscape, weigh the trade-offs, plan strategically, and embark on a multicloud journey that aligns seamlessly with your unique business objectives.